  • 500 g bell peppers, use a mix of green and red for color and sweetness

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

  • 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der optional

  • 1/2 teaspoon sweet paprika optional

Instructions

  1. Begin by washing the peppers under cold water and patting them dry. Remove the stems and seeds, then slice into thin strips or rings based on preference.

  2. In a large bowl, toss the peppers with olive oil until every piece glistens. Add sal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and paprika if using, and mix well to ensure even seasoning.

  3. Preheat the air fryer to two hundred degrees Celsius. Once at temperature, arrange the peppers in a single layer inside the basket to avoid crowding and promote uniform cooking.

  4. Cook for ten to twelve minutes, shaking halfway through to promote even browning. The peppers should become tender and acquire a light bronze hue when finished.

  5. Transfer the fried peppers to a plate lined with paper towels to blot excess oil if needed, then serve hot.

  6. Pair the peppers with a tangy yogurt herb sauce, aioli, or any preferred dip to complement the flavors.
